diff --git a/Assets/AmplifyShaderEditor/Plugins/Editor/CustomDrawers/EditableIf.cs b/Assets/AmplifyShaderEditor/Plugins/Editor/CustomDrawers/EditableIf.cs deleted file mode 100644 index e94e02ed..00000000 --- a/Assets/AmplifyShaderEditor/Plugins/Editor/CustomDrawers/EditableIf.cs +++ /dev/null @@ -1,294 +0,0 @@ -// Amplify Shader Editor - Visual Shader Editing Tool -// Copyright (c) Amplify Creations, Lda <info@amplify.pt> -// -// Donated by BinaryCats -// https://forum.unity.com/threads/best-tool-asset-store-award-amplify-shader-editor-node-based-shader-creation-tool.430959/page-60#post-3414465 -////////////////////// -// README / HOW TO USE -////////////////////// -// Examples: -// -// Floats: -// -// x Equals value -// EditableIf( _float1, Equalto, 1) -// This will allow the value to be edited, if the property _float1 is equal to 1. (_float1==1) -// Note: NotEqualTo is also a valid argument which will do the opposite of this example.EditableIf(_float1, NotEqualTo, 1) (NotEqualTo != 1) -// -// x Greater than value -// EditableIf(_Float1,GreaterThan,1) -// This will allow the value to be edited if the property _float1 is Greater than 1. (_float1>1) -// -// x Greater Than Or Equal to value -// EditableIf(_Float1,GreaterThanOrEqualTo,1) -// This will allow the value to be edited if the property _float1 is Greater than or equal to 1. (_float1>=1) -// -// -// x Less Than value -// EditableIf(_Float1,LessThan,1) -// This will allow the value to be edited if the property _float1 is Less than 1. (_float1<1) -// -// x Less Than Or Equal to value -// EditableIf(_Float1,LessThanOrEqualTo,1) -// This will allow the value to be edited if the property _float1 is Less than or equal to 1. (_float1<=1) -// -// -// Colour: -// -// x Equals r,g,b,a -// EditableIf(_Color0,EqualTo,255,255,255,255) -// This will allow the value to be edited, if the property _Color0 R,G,B and A value all Equal 255. (_Color0.R==255 && _Color0.G==255 & _Color0.B == 255 && _Color0.A == 255) -// -// x Equals alpha -// EditableIf(_Color0,EqualTo,null,null,null,255) -// This will allow the value to be edited, if the property _Color0 Alpha value is Equal to 255. (_Color0.A == 255) -// -// a Greater than blue -// EditableIf(_Color0,GreaterThan,null,null,125) -// This will allow the value to be edited, if the property _Color0 Blue value is Greater Than 125. (_Color0.B > 125) -// Note: as I do not want to check the Red or Green Values, i have entered "null" for the parameter -// Note: I have not inputted a value to check for Alpha, as i do not want to check it. Simularly, if I wanted to Only check the Red Value I could have used EditableIf(_Color0,GreaterThan,125) -// -// Like wise with floats GreaterThanOrEqualTo, LessThan, LessThanOrEqualTo -// -// Vector: -// Vector Checks work the same as colour checks -// -// Texture: -// x Does Not have a Texture -// EditableIf(_TextureSample0,Equals,null) -// This will allow the value to be edited, if the property _TextureSample0 does NOT have a texture -// -// x Does have a Texture -// EditableIf(_TextureSample0,NotEqualTo,null) -// This will allow the value to be edited, if the property _TextureSample0 does have a texture - -using UnityEngine; -using UnityEditor; -using System; - -public enum ComparisonOperators -{ - EqualTo, NotEqualTo, GreaterThan, LessThan, EqualsOrGreaterThan, EqualsOrLessThan, ContainsFlags, - DoesNotContainsFlags -} - -public class EditableIf : MaterialPropertyDrawer -{ - ComparisonOperators op; - string FieldName = ""; - object ExpectedValue; - bool InputError; - public EditableIf() - { - InputError = true; - } - public EditableIf( object fieldname, object comparison, object expectedvalue ) - { - if( expectedvalue.ToString().ToLower() == "true" ) - { - expectedvalue = (System.Single)1; - } - else if( expectedvalue.ToString().ToLower() == "false" ) - { - expectedvalue = (System.Single)0; - - } - Init( fieldname, comparison, expectedvalue ); - - } - public EditableIf( object fieldname, object comparison, object expectedvaluex, object expectedvaluey ) - { - float? x = expectedvaluex as float?; - float? y = expectedvaluey as float?; - float? z = float.NegativeInfinity; - float? w = float.NegativeInfinity; - x = GetVectorValue( x ); - y = GetVectorValue( y ); - - Init( fieldname, comparison, new Vector4( x.Value, y.Value, z.Value, w.Value ) ); - } - public EditableIf( object fieldname, object comparison, object expectedvaluex, object expectedvaluey, object expectedvaluez ) - { - float? x = expectedvaluex as float?; - float? y = expectedvaluey as float?; - float? z = expectedvaluez as float?; - float? w = float.NegativeInfinity; - x = GetVectorValue( x ); - y = GetVectorValue( y ); - z = GetVectorValue( z ); - - Init( fieldname, comparison, new Vector4( x.Value, y.Value, z.Value, w.Value ) ); - - } - public EditableIf( object fieldname, object comparison, object expectedvaluex, object expectedvaluey, object expectedvaluez, object expectedvaluew ) - { - var x = expectedvaluex as float?; - var y = expectedvaluey as float?; - var z = expectedvaluez as float?; - var w = expectedvaluew as float?; - x = GetVectorValue( x ); - y = GetVectorValue( y ); - z = GetVectorValue( z ); - w = GetVectorValue( w ); - - Init( fieldname, comparison, new Vector4( x.Value, y.Value, z.Value, w.Value ) ); - - } - - private void Init( object fieldname, object comparison, object expectedvalue ) - { - FieldName = fieldname.ToString(); - var names = Enum.GetNames( typeof( ComparisonOperators ) ); - var name = comparison.ToString().ToLower().Replace( " ", "" ); - - for( int i = 0; i < names.Length; i++ ) - { - if( names[ i ].ToLower() == name ) - { - op = (ComparisonOperators)i; - break; - } - } - - ExpectedValue = expectedvalue; - } - - private static float?
